What affects the price

Replacing your windows with impact-rated glass involves a few variables that shift your final total. First, the size and number of openings in your home play the biggest role, as custom measurements require more material and labor. The style of window you choose—like single-hung, casement, or sliders—also changes the math, as does the frame material, such as vinyl versus aluminum. If you live in an area with stricter wind-load requirements, that might necessitate thicker glass or specialized hardware.

What is an impact window?

An impact window is constructed with a strong interlayer between two panes of glass, making it highly resistant to shattering from impacts. This design provides superior protection against high winds and flying debris, which is crucial for safeguarding your Madison home during severe weather events.
